YourSuper comparison tool

The YourSuper comparison tool is a simple way to compare MySuper products and help you choose a super fund that meets your needs. It is hosted by the Australian Taxation Office (ATO).

Super trustees urged to improve delivery of insurance outcomes for members

22 March 2023

Trustees need to continue to focus on improving the life insurance they provide their members. A recent review highlights areas where trustees should be making meaningful improvements to deliver better member outcomes.

ASIC publishes report on good practices for handling whistleblower disclosures

2 March 2023

ASIC has published a report to help entities improve their arrangements for handling whistleblower disclosures. REP 758 sets out the good practices ASIC observed from its review of seven entities’ whistleblower programs from a cross-section of industries.

ASIC issues infringement notice against superannuation trustee for greenwashing

23 December 2022

ASIC has issued an infringement notice to Diversa Trustees Limited in further action against alleged greenwashing.

Superannuation trustees on notice to uplift complaints handling

9 December 2022

Trustees are on notice to improve their internal dispute resolution systems after a targeted review of trustee compliance with the enforceable complaints handling requirements found that some trustees had sub‑standard arrangements for managing complaints.
